if you are used to mocha fraps and other sweet flavored drinks, you'll be disappointed in iced coffee. It's just coffee over ice. But you will love the vanilla and white chocolate fraps.

Both the caramel and the white mocha fraps are sweeter than the mocha. I would suggest trying the caramel or try adding mint to the mocha. I think you'll love any of them, though!
